Bookroo's summary

Madeline Tock, a graveyard dweller, shatters the Night Mother’s lantern, releasing trapped souls, including her father's. With her friend Nura, she ventures into the Moon’s depths, facing nightfire and the Sleep Ensemble. In the Night Mother’s Lunar Mansion, Maddy confronts a choice: become the next Night Mother to save her father or remain true to herself, risking everything. Will she find a way to free the souls and restore balance, or will the Moon's shadows claim her? A tale of courage and heart unfolds in a world where light is a distant memory.

From the publisher

The moon is stuck. Sunlight is a distant memory. And the Night Mother, who once represented harmony between the living and the dead, has been thwarted by the girl who lives in the graveyard named Madeline Tock. But after their daring escape to the Moon, Maddy and her new friend, Nura, have accidentally shattered the Night Mother’s lantern and the stolen souls within it have escaped, including the soul of Maddy’s father. Maddy and Nura follow the souls into the cavernous city spiraling down into the Moon’s largest crater. There, Maddy and Nura will face nightfire, the dreaded Sleep Ensemble, and the many crooked corridors of the Night Mother’s Lunar Mansion. If they survive, they just might be able to right the wrongs of the Night Mother and free the souls she took from the living. But their journey will bring everything to bear on Maddy, who has an impossible choice to make: become the next Night Mother and rescue her father’s soul . . . or stay true to herself and risk everything. Storytellers Jeremy Lambert (Goosebumps) and Alexa Sharpe (Lumberjanes) reunite to weave an evocative and magical tale of a young woman discovering what’s faithfully in her heart.
